Executive Director of the Woodstock Film Festival, Meira Blaustein returns to the podcast to discuss the 2020 Hudson Valley institution (the 21st year!) which she describes as two festivals in one: there’s the virtual festival which you can watch from the comfort of home, and the drive-ins which will take place in both Greenville, NY as well as in Woodstock. The festival takes place from September 30th through October 4th.

Actor and filmmaker Frank Mosley (“Ain’t Them Body Saints)”, “The Ghost Who Walks”) returns to the podcast to discuss his latest film work. He’s acting in both “Freeland” as well as “Dear Mr. Brody) both of which are screening at the Woodstock Film Festival. We had on the co-directors of “Freeland” recently so we pick up the conversation about that film in this segment. Coming up from that same film we will be chatting with its star, Krisha Fairchild.
